Overall Meaning

The song "Time Is Running Out" by Burning Image raises the issue of apathy and complacency in society. The lyrics suggest that people often stop caring and become numb to the problems around them, eventually becoming part of the masses that they once criticized. The song makes a reference to the fact that people often choose to blame others for societal issues rather than taking responsibility and making changes themselves. The passage "It's all fault, we let it happen / We tried to get you all to understand / Now it's too late, to really change things / We've got to realize now just where we stand" highlights this frustration and helplessness that arises when people feel like they have failed to inspire change and are now at the mercy of the consequences. The chorus "Time is Running Out, Times are changing / Time is Running Out / Don't worry about what they think, they can't think any way / They're going to live and die the way they are" emphasizes the idea that time is running out and that we need to start taking action before it's too late.


The song paints a bleak picture of the future and suggests that we are already living in a "brave new world", a world where change might not be possible. The repetition of the line "Time is Running Out" throughout the song further strengthens this sense of urgency and desperation. The final verse of the song "You never know, we just might change things / If I were you, I wouldn't hold my breath / You promised us you'd make things better / You've got us living in a brave new world" highlights the mistrust and skepticism that people have towards those in power. The song suggests that despite the promises made by leaders, people are still living in a world that has not seen much positive change.


Overall, "Time Is Running Out" is a powerful song that highlights the dangers of apathy and complacency in society. It emphasizes the need for action and change if we want to create a better future for ourselves.
